Bring Back HUAC
By Judson Cox (11/21/04)

Now that the political silly season is over, and I am on record as saying the best thing for the Republican party would be for liberals to continue making the kind of loony, anti-American statements that alienate the country, perhaps I can deal with the serious issues of treason and sedition without being accused of partisan motives.

Debate, protest and even conscientious objection to war are essential elements of our political system, which is why such activities are protected by our Constitution. Treason is taking up arms against our nation, or giving aid and comfort to our enemies. Sedition is actively encouraging acts of treason. Treasonous and seditious activities are illegal; they are not protected as free speech.

America has dealt with treason in the past – Benedict Arnold, the Rosenbergs and Tokyo Rose to name a few cases. Arnold was guilty of spying for and aiding the British in our nation’s nescience, and fled to England to escape execution. The Rosenbergs were Soviet spies, executed for passing nuclear secrets to the enemy. Although many on the Left defend them to this day, the “Venona Cables” (decoded Soviet communicates) confirm their espionage, and Khrushchev identified them as Soviet spies in his memoirs. Tokyo Rose (Iva Ikuko Toguri) was tried for her role in anti-American propaganda on behalf of the Imperial Japanese government during World War Two. She was found guilty, but later pardoned when it was proved that she had been forced to partake in treasonous activities against her will, and that she sought to undermine the Japanese as best she could.

These cases show the variety that treason can take, and the complexity of such charges. All were sympathetic characters to varying degrees, but were prosecuted for aiding enemies of the United States. Even though Tokyo Rose was later pardoned, these cases illustrate how seriously treason was once taken in America. In more reasonable times, treason and sedition were crimes, for which death was the likely penalty.
